    Abstract: A honing machine (100) for honing a bore in a workpiece comprises a support structure (120) fixed to the machine and at least one honing unit (130) which is mounted on the support structure and which has a main support (160), which can be mounted fixedly in relation to the support structure, and a spindle unit (150), which is supported by the main support and in which a spindle shaft (152) is rotatably mounted, wherein the spindle shaft (152) is rotatable about a spindle axis (155) by means of a rotary drive and, at a tool-side end (153), has a device for the fastening of a honing tool. The honing machine furthermore has a linear guide system which is arranged between the main support (160) and the spindle unit (150) and which serves for guiding a linear stroke movement of the spindle unit (150) relative to the main support (160), a stroke drive for generating the stroke movement of the spindle unit (150), and an alignment system (200) for setting the alignment of the spindle axis (155) in relation to the support structure (120). The alignment system (200) is designed for the continuously variable, reversible setting of the alignment of the spindle axis (155) in relation to the support structure (120), wherein the alignment system is designed for the independent setting of the position of the spindle axis (155) along two mutually perpendicular axes of translation and for the setting of the orientation of the spindle axis (155) in relation to two mutually perpendicular axes of rotation.

    Abstract: In the double-side polishing apparatus, one end part of a slurry supply hole has a female-tapered face whose inner diameter is gradually increased toward a polishing face of a polishing plate. A pad hole, which corresponds to the slurry supply hole, is formed in a polishing pad covering the slurry supply hole. An edge of the pad hole is located in the slurry supply hole. A fixation pipe, in which a flange section facing the female-tapered face is formed at one end part, is fixed in the slurry supply hole. The edge of the pad hole is sandwiched and held between the female-tapered face of the slurry supply hole and the flange section of the fixation pipe.

    Abstract: A dental crown polishing apparatus has a motor, a ball bearing assembly around a shaft of the motor and having balls rotating and circularly moving around the motor shaft by receiving torque from the motor shaft, a brush assembly on the periphery of the ball bearing assembly, equipped with brushes contacting the ball to rotate and having bristles in the same direction as an axial direction of rotation and a tray opposite and open to the brush assembly to dispose a crown toward the brushes. The motor shaft is offset from the center of the brush assembly. The brush assembly moves in an orbital fashion by the rotation of the motor. The tray rotates separately from the brush assembly. The rotation of the tray is not synchronous with the rotation of the brush assembly. Dental crown polishing is achieved by the orbital movement of the brushes.

    Abstract: A one piece plastic or two piece, metal and plastic, retaining ring used for chemical mechanical polishing of semiconductor substrates. In one embodiment, the plastic is selected from polyphenylene sulfide (PPS), polyethylene terephthalate, polyetheretherketone, polybutylene terephthalate, Ertalyte TX, PEEK, Torlon, Delrin, PET, Vespel, or Duratrol. The plastic wear surface is hardened by electron beam or gamma ray irradiation.
